About the Lucan Area Heritage and Donnelly Museum:

Founded in 1995 the Lucan Area Heritage & Donnelly Museum (LAHDM) serves the
town of Lucan and the surrounding area. Located in the heart of Lucan, it is an integral part of the community and serves as an important cultural space. We seek to preserve the region’s history and educate the community about it. From the indigenous origins of the area, to the establishment of the Wilberforce Settlement, and the notorious Donnelly story, Lucan has a fascinating and culturally diverse history.

About the position:

The LAHDM is currently seeking a student for the position of Museum Registrar. The Museum Registrar will participate in the museum’s ongoing project to improve documentation of its collection by researching artifacts, and updating/creating detailed catalog records in the museum’s database. Tasks include, but are not limited to: adding detailed descriptions to database records, photographing/scanning artifacts, and adding condition reports and location records to database.
